+/* -*- Mode: Java; c-basic-offset: 4; tab-width: 20; indent-tabs-mode: nil; -*-
+ * This Source Code Form is subject to the terms of the Mozilla Public
+ * License, v. 2.0. If a copy of the MPL was not distributed with this
+ * file, You can obtain one at http://mozilla.org/MPL/2.0/. */
+
+package org.mozilla.gecko.gfx;
+
+import android.os.SystemClock;
+import android.util.Log;
+import java.util.ArrayList;
+import java.util.List;
+import org.mozilla.gecko.annotation.RobocopTarget;
+
+public final class PanningPerfAPI {
+ private static final String LOGTAG = "GeckoPanningPerfAPI";
+
+ // make this large enough to avoid having to resize the frame time
+ // list, as that may be expensive and impact the thing we're trying
+ // to measure.
+ private static final int EXPECTED_FRAME_COUNT = 2048;
+
+ private static boolean mRecordingFrames;
+ private static List<Long> mFrameTimes;
+ private static long mFrameStartTime;
+
+ private static void initialiseRecordingArrays() {
+ if (mFrameTimes == null) {
+ mFrameTimes = new ArrayList<Long>(EXPECTED_FRAME_COUNT);
+ } else {
+ mFrameTimes.clear();
+ }
+ }
+
+ @RobocopTarget
+ public static void startFrameTimeRecording() {
+ if (mRecordingFrames) {
+ Log.e(LOGTAG, "Error: startFrameTimeRecording() called while already recording!");
+ return;
+ }
+ mRecordingFrames = true;
+ initialiseRecordingArrays();
+ mFrameStartTime = SystemClock.uptimeMillis();
+ }
+
+ @RobocopTarget
+ public static List<Long> stopFrameTimeRecording() {
+ if (!mRecordingFrames) {
+ Log.e(LOGTAG, "Error: stopFrameTimeRecording() called when not recording!");
+ return null;
+ }
+ mRecordingFrames = false;
+ return mFrameTimes;
+ }
+
+ public static void recordFrameTime() {
+ // this will be called often, so try to make it as quick as possible
+ if (mRecordingFrames) {
+ mFrameTimes.add(SystemClock.uptimeMillis() - mFrameStartTime);
+ }
+ }
+
+ @RobocopTarget
+ public static void startCheckerboardRecording() {
+ throw new UnsupportedOperationException();
+ }
+
+ @RobocopTarget
+ public static List<Float> stopCheckerboardRecording() {
+ throw new UnsupportedOperationException();
+ }
+}
